Understanding the Fundamentals

Before diving into performance enhancement strategies, it’s vital to have a strong foundation in the basics of CNC (Computer Numeric Control), PLC (Programmable Logic Controllers), and SCADA (Supervisory Control and Data Acquisition). You should be familiar with their roles in industrial automation and how they interact within the operational ecosystem.

CNC Systems

CNC machines are used for precise control of industrial tools. Understanding the key components of CNC such as controllers, actuators, and the types of CNC machines can significantly aid in troubleshooting and improving production efficiency.

PLC Systems

PLCs are critical for industrial automation, providing real-time monitoring and control of processes. Having an in-depth understanding of PLC programming languages (like Ladder Logic) and configuration tuning can enhance the reliability and flexibility of manufacturing operations.

SCADA Systems

SCADA enables data acquisition and control at a supervisory level. Expertise in SCADA can allow for improved data-driven decisions, ensuring that real-time data reflects accurately across operational platforms.

Enhance Maintenance Strategies

Improving your maintenance strategies can boost efficiency and prolong the lifespan of your systems. Consider the following:

Preventive Maintenance

Implement a robust preventive maintenance schedule. Regular checks and balances help detect issues before they evolve into major problems, reducing downtime and maintenance costs.

Condition-Based Maintenance

Adopt condition-based maintenance by leveraging data from SCADA systems to predict when maintenance is needed based on the actual condition of the equipment. This ensures maintenance activities are carried out just when needed, optimizing both uptime and resource usage.
